PDH_RAW_COUNTER 구조체(pdh.h)

PDH_RAW_COUNTER 구조체는 카운터 공급자로부터 수집된 데이터를 반환합니다. 데이터에 대해 번역, 서식 또는 기타 해석이 수행되지 않습니다.

구문

typedef struct _PDH_RAW_COUNTER {
  DWORD    CStatus;
  FILETIME TimeStamp;
  LONGLONG FirstValue;
  LONGLONG SecondValue;
  DWORD    MultiCount;
} PDH_RAW_COUNTER, *PPDH_RAW_COUNTER;

멤버

CStatus

카운터 값이 유효한지 나타내는 카운터 상태. 계산에서 데이터를 사용하거나 해당 값을 표시하기 전에 이 멤버를 확인합니다. 가능한 값 목록은 PDH 인터페이스 반환 값 확인을 참조하세요.

TimeStamp

데이터가 수집된 시점의 현지 시간( FILETIME 형식)입니다.

FirstValue

첫 번째 원시 카운터 값입니다.

SecondValue

두 번째 원시 카운터 값입니다. 속도 카운터는 표시 가능한 값을 계산하기 위해 두 개의 값이 필요합니다.

MultiCount

카운터 형식에 PERF_MULTI_COUNTER 플래그가 포함된 경우 이 멤버는 계산에 사용된 추가 카운터 데이터를 포함합니다. 예를 들어 PERF_100NSEC_MULTI_TIMER 카운터 형식에는 PERF_MULTI_COUNTER 플래그가 포함됩니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ows XP [데스크톱 앱만 해당]
지원되는 최소 서버 Windows Server 2003 [데스크톱 앱만 해당]
머리글 pdh.h

추가 정보

PdhCalculateCounterFromRawValue

PdhComputeCounterStatistics

PdhGetRawCounterValue